Question 2 Capital University, a midsized university in a capital city recently received an offer from BrainTrust Teaching Services to teach all of the first year accounting courses at the university. There are currently 10 sections of 1st year accounting taught at Capital University. Cost per section are as follows: Description Cost Professors $20,000 $4,000 $2,000 Classroom/building Teaching Assistants Notes Half of these costs can be avoided by laying off staff This space can not be used for other purposes All costs can be avoided As well, it is estimated that fixed administrative costs are $1,000 per section. BrainTrust has proposed that they can teach all of the sections for a total cost of $105,000 Should Capital accept this special offer? (include both qualitative and quantitative analysis)
